TV, VCR, and Cable Box Connecting Your TV Rear of TV 3 VCR 2 Cable Box 4 1 From cable 1 34 5 Y S VIDEO PB PR AUDIO OUT (VAR/FIX) VIDEO L (MONO) R L (MONO) R Video (yellow) Audio L (white) Audio R (red) 1 Connect the coaxial cable from your cable service to the IN jack on your cable box. 2 Connect a coaxial cable (not supplied) from the OUT jack on your cable box to the IN jack on your VCR. 3 Connect a coaxial cable (not supplied) from the OUT jack on your VCR to the VHF/UHF jack on the TV. 4 If your VCR is equipped with video outputs, you can get better picture quality by connecting audio/video cables (not supplied) from AUDIO/VIDEO OUT on your VCR to AUDIO/VIDEO IN on your TV. Optional connection ❏ For better picture quality, use S VIDEO inserted of the yellow video cable. S VIDEO does not provide sound, so you still must connect the audio cables. Using your TV with this connection ❏ Program your Sony remote control to operate your VCR or cable box (see page 5). ❏ To activate your remote, press to operate your VCR or to operate your cable box. To do this, first program your remote control, then use the Channel Fix feature to set your TV to channel 3 or 4 (see page 29). ❏ Press repeatedly to switch between VCR input (VIDEO input), VHF/UHF (local channels or unscrambled), or cable box (cable system or scrambled channels). 15
